When to Consider Spaying or Neutering

While there's no specific age limit for spaying or neutering, certain breeds might need it at different stages. For instance, smaller dogs might be spayed or neutered between 6-8 months, while larger breeds might need to wait until 8-10 months. It's all about finding that sweet spot.

Health Benefits

Spaying and neutering come with a host of health benefits. For females, it can prevent uterine infections and breast cancer. For males, it can reduce the risk of testicular cancer and prostate issues. Plus, it's a great way to control pet overpopulation.
